Margherita Pizza Easy Weeknight Dinners
Ingredients:
- 1 (16-18 oz) ball of pizza dough
- 1/2 cup tomato sauce
- 8 oz fresh mozzarella cheese, sliced
- 10-12 fresh basil leaves
- 2 tbsp olive oil
- Salt, to taste
- Black pepper, to taste
Instructions:
- Preheat your oven to 500°F or the highest temperature your oven can reach. If you have a pizza stone, place it in the oven to preheat.
- Roll out the pizza dough on a lightly floured surface to form a 12-14 inch circle. Place the dough on parchment paper or a pizza peel if using a pizza stone.
- Spread the tomato sauce evenly over the pizza dough, leaving a 1/2-inch border.
- Arrange the sliced mozzarella cheese on top of the sauce.
- Tear the basil leaves into smaller pieces and sprinkle them over the cheese.
- Drizzle the olive oil over the pizza.
- Season with salt and pepper to taste.
- Transfer the pizza to the oven and bake for 8-10 minutes, or until the crust is golden brown and the cheese is melted and bubbly.
- Remove the pizza from the oven and allow it to cool for a few minutes.
- Slice and serve hot.
